PiedRéseau Longueuil offers a specialized service in plantar orthotics, designed to enhance foot function and address various biomechanical issues. Our custom-made foot orthotics are tailored specifically to the unique shape of your feet, ensuring optimal support and pressure redistribution. This service is crucial for alleviating pain and treating a range of foot conditions, allowing you to maintain your daily activities comfortably. The process begins with a thorough evaluation by our podiatrists, who will create a personalized casting of your feet to ensure the orthotics are perfectly suited to your needs. With advancements in technology, our orthotics are durable and can last between 5 to 10 years, providing long-term benefits for your foot health.
